README

Okta Auth0 logs event collector integration for Cortex XSIAM.
This integration was integrated and tested with version 2.0 of Okta Auth0.
Please see the Okta Auth0 rate limit policy.

Configure Okta Auth0 Event Collector in Cortex

Parameter Description Required
Server URL   True
Client ID The API key to use for connection. True
Client Secret   True
First fetch (<number> <time unit>, e.g., 12 hours, 7 days)   False
The maximum number of events per fetch   False
Trust any certificate (not secure)   False
Use system proxy settings   False

Commands

You can execute these commands from the CLI, as part of an automation, or in a playbook.
After you successfully execute a command, a DBot message appears in the War Room with the command details.

okta-auth0-get-events


Manual command to fetch events and display them.

Base Command

okta-auth0-get-events

Input

Argument Name Description Required
should_push_events If true, the command will create events, otherwise it will only display them. Possible values are: true, false. Default is false. Required
limit Maximum number of results to return. Maximum is 2000. Default is 10. Optional
since Occurrence time of the least recent event to include (inclusive). Default is 3 days. Optional

Context Output

There is no context output for this command.

import time

import demistomock as demisto
from CommonServerPython import *

""" CONSTANTS """

DATE_FORMAT = "%Y-%m-%dT%H:%M:%SZ"
VENDOR = "okta"
PRODUCT = "auth0"
DEFAULT_LIMIT = 1000
TOKEN_TIME_TO_EXPIRE = 23 * 60 * 60  # https://auth0.com/docs/secure/tokens/access-tokens/get-access-tokens#renew-access-tokens


""" HELPER FUNCTIONS """


def arg_to_strtime(value: Any) -> Optional[str]:
    if datetime_obj := arg_to_datetime(value):
        return datetime_obj.strftime(DATE_FORMAT)
    return None


def prepare_query_params(params: dict, last_run: dict = {}) -> dict:
    """
    Parses the given inputs into Okta Auth0 Events API expected params format.
    """
    query_params = {}

    if not last_run:  # requesting by time query
        since = arg_to_strtime(params.get("since"))
        query_params = {"q": f"date:[{since} TO *]", "sort": "date:1", "per_page": 100}

    else:  # requesting by log_id
        query_params = {"from": last_run.get("last_id"), "sort": "date:1", "take": 100}

    return query_params


def get_access_token_from_context() -> Optional[str]:
    """Returns an access token if exists in the integration context and is not expired. Otherwise, returns None.
    Returns:
        Optional[str]: A valid access token, or `None`.
    """
    int_context = get_integration_context()
    if (
        "token_creation_time" not in int_context
        or int(time.time()) - int_context.get("token_creation_time", 1) > TOKEN_TIME_TO_EXPIRE
    ):
        return None
    return int_context["access_token"]


""" CLIENT CLASS """


class Client(BaseClient):
    def __init__(self, base_url, client_id, client_secret, verify, proxy):
        super().__init__(base_url, verify, proxy, headers={})
        self.client_id = client_id
        self.client_secret = client_secret

        self.access_token = self.get_access_token()
        self._headers.update({"Authorization": f"Bearer {self.access_token}"})

    def get_access_token_request(self):
        """
        Send request to get an access token from Okta Auth0.
        """
        body = {
            "client_id": self.client_id,
            "client_secret": self.client_secret,
            "audience": f"{self._base_url}/api/v2/",
            "grant_type": "client_credentials",
        }

        raw_response = self._http_request(method="POST", url_suffix="/oauth/token", data=body)

        demisto.debug("Successfully got access token.")
        return raw_response

    def get_access_token(self):
        """Get the access token from the integration context if it has not expired.

        Returns:
            str: The access token.
        """
        if not (access_token := get_access_token_from_context()):
            access_token = self.get_access_token_request()["access_token"]
            set_integration_context({"access_token": access_token, "token_creation_time": int(time.time())})

        return access_token

    def get_events_request(self, query_params: dict) -> list:
        """
        Send request to get events from Okta Auth0.
        """
        raw_response = self._http_request(method="GET", url_suffix="/api/v2/logs", params=query_params)

        demisto.info(f"Succesfully got {len(raw_response)} events.")
        return raw_response

    def fetch_events(self, query_params: dict, last_run: dict, fetch_events_limit: Optional[int] = 1000) -> List[dict]:
        """
        Aggregates logs from Okta Auth0 and updates the last run object with the ID of the latest fetched log.

        Args:
            query_params (dict): The query params to fetch the events.
            last_run (dict): The lastRun object to update for the next fetch.
            fetch_events_limit (int): The fetch limit parameter configured in the instance.

        Return:
            (list[dict]): The list of the aggregated events.
        """
        aggregated_events: List[dict] = []

        events = self.get_events_request(query_params)
        try:
            while events:
                for event in events:
                    if len(aggregated_events) == fetch_events_limit:
                        demisto.info(f"Reached the user-defined limit ({fetch_events_limit}) - stopping.")
                        last_run["last_id"] = aggregated_events[-1].get("_id")
                        break

                    aggregated_events.append(event)

                else:
                    # Finished iterating through all events in this batch
                    query_params.update({"from": aggregated_events[-1].get("_id"), "take": 100})
                    events = self.get_events_request(query_params)
                    continue

                demisto.info("Finished iterating through all events in this fetch run.")
                break
        except DemistoException as e:
            if not e.res or e.res.status_code != 429:
                raise e
            demisto.info("Reached API rate limit, storing last id")

        if aggregated_events:
            last_run["last_id"] = aggregated_events[-1].get("_id")

        return aggregated_events


""" COMMAND FUNCTIONS """


def test_module_command(client: Client, params: dict, last_run: dict) -> str:
    """
    Tests connection with Okta Auth0.
    Args:
        client (Client): The client implementing the API to Okta Auth0.
        params (dict): The configuration parameters.
        last_run (dict): the lastRun object, holding information from the previous fetch run.

    Returns:
        (str) 'ok' if success.
    """
    fetch_events_command(client, params, last_run)
    return "ok"


def get_events_command(client: Client, args: dict) -> tuple[list, CommandResults]:
    """
    Gets log events from Okta Auth0.
    Args:
        client (Client): the client implementing the API to Okta Auth0.
        args (dict): the command arguments.

    Returns:
        (list) the events retrieved from the API call.
        (CommandResults) the CommandResults object holding the collected events information.
    """
    query_params = prepare_query_params(args)
    events = client.fetch_events(query_params, {}, args.get("limit", 100))
    results = CommandResults(
        raw_response=events,
        readable_output=tableToMarkdown("Okta Auth0 Events", events, date_fields=["date"], removeNull=True),
    )
    return events, results


def fetch_events_command(client: Client, params: dict, last_run: dict) -> tuple:
    """
    Collects log events from Okta Auth0 using pagination.
    Args:
        client (Client): the client implementing the API to Okta Auth0.
        params (dict): the instance configuration parameters.
        last_run (dict): the lastRun object, holding information from the previous run.

    Returns:
        (list) the events retrieved from the API call.
        (dict) the updated lastRun object.
    """
    query_params = prepare_query_params(params, last_run)
    fetch_events_limit = arg_to_number(params.get("limit", DEFAULT_LIMIT))
    events = client.fetch_events(query_params, last_run, fetch_events_limit)
    return events, last_run


""" MAIN FUNCTION """


def add_time_to_events(events):
    """
    Adds the _time key to the events.
    Args:
        events: List[Dict] - list of events to add the _time key to.
    """
    if events:
        for event in events:
            create_time = arg_to_datetime(arg=event.get("date"))
            event["_time"] = create_time.strftime(DATE_FORMAT) if create_time else None


def main() -> None:
    command = demisto.command()
    params = demisto.params()
    args = demisto.args()

    demisto.info(f"Command being called is {command}")
    try:
        client_id = params.get("credentials", {}).get("identifier")
        client_secret = params.get("credentials", {}).get("password")

        client = Client(
            base_url=params.get("url"),
            client_id=client_id,
            client_secret=client_secret,
            verify=not params.get("insecure", False),
            proxy=params.get("proxy", False),
        )
        last_run = demisto.getLastRun()

        if command == "test-module":
            return_results(test_module_command(client, params, last_run))

        elif command == "okta-auth0-get-events":
            events, results = get_events_command(client, args)
            return_results(results)
            if argToBoolean(args.get("should_push_events", "false")):
                add_time_to_events(events)
                send_events_to_xsiam(events, vendor=VENDOR, product=PRODUCT)

        elif command == "fetch-events":
            events, last_run = fetch_events_command(client, params, last_run)
            add_time_to_events(events)
            send_events_to_xsiam(events, vendor=VENDOR, product=PRODUCT)
            demisto.setLastRun(last_run)

    except Exception as e:
        return_error(f"Failed to execute {command} command.\nError:\n{e}")


""" ENTRY POINT """


if __name__ in ("__main__", "__builtin__", "builtins"):
    main()
